LiPo's in parallel?

by "RogerN" <regor@[EMAIL PROTECTED] > Oct 9, 2008 at 09:37 AM

Since LiPo's are charged at constant voltage, if you were to make a harness

with perhaps 1/2 Ohm between each pack, would it be possible to 
charge/discharge multiple LiPo's in parallel?

For example, after returning home from the field, connect all discharged 
batteries to a parallel adapter connected to a balancer.  The adapter
would 
have small value resistors to limit the current between packs since they
are 
most likely not discharged to the same voltage.  If you aren't going back
to 
the field until next week, set the charger to charge to storage voltage of

approx. 3.8V per cell.  Then start the charge before the next planned use.

Advantages: All packs are stored at storage voltage and all packs are 
charged to be ready before use.  Use a single charger on multiple packs.

Need: Mating connectors for balance plugs and ~ 1/2 Ohm resistors to limit

current in case you throw in fully charged pack with discharged packs. 
Fuses  or other current limiting devices would be needed if you might
throw 
in a discharged pack with multiple charged packs.
